WGU D199 PRE-ASSESSMENT: INTRODUCTION TO
PHYSICAL AND HUMAN GEOGRAPHY
Which situation is a strong example of an advantageous relative location?

A. A city improves its irrigation system.
B. A city improves its river trade.
C. A city promotes solar energy.
D. A city promotes rooftop gardens. - Answers -B. A city improves its river trade

How might changes in the supply of energy, temperature, or light affect an ecosystem?

A. The ecosystem's biome might also be harmed.
B. The ecosystem's species might suddenly multiply.
C. The ecosystem's structure might be significantly altered.
D. The ecosystem's resilience might be strengthened. - Answers -C. The ecosystem's
structure might be significantly altered.

What is the key principle regarding energy losses within the cycle of the ecosystem?

A. They are an inevitable part of the process.
B. The harm the health of the system.
C. The lead to depleted biotic communities.
D. The lead to rich abiotic communities. - Answers -A. They are an inevitable part of the
process.

Why is the service economy so important to low-income countries?

A. It produces the food and basic goods of the nation.
B. It encourages young people to pursue education.
C. It promotes strong competition with wealthier countries.
D. It employs more than half of the population. - Answers -D. It employs more than half
of the population.

Which factor does Weber believe determines where a business is located?

A. Labor costs
B. Raw materials
C. Energy costs
D. Transportation - Answers -A. Labor costs

Why have extreme natural boundaries often determined the borders of modern nations?

A. They never change, so they are reliable markers of territory.
B. They tend to create neighboring lands with different cultures.

, C. They are easy to determine and draw on a map.
D. They can easily be included in international treaties. - Answers -B. They tend to
create neighboring lands with different cultures.

What is a key factor that makes India the greatest exporter of migrants to the Gulf
States, the United States, and the United Kingdom?

A. A deterioration of India's higher education standards
B. Social crises such as India's attack on minorities
C. The advent of artificial intelligence (AI)
D. A lack of universal prekindergarten schooling for children - Answers -B. Social crises
such as India's attack on minorities

Which statement is true regarding the environmental risk of rising sea levels to both
Bangladesh and the Netherlands?

A. Bangladesh and the Netherlands have the same degree of environmental risk
because they both have extensive low-elevation coastal zones.
B. Bangladesh has a greater environmental risk than the Netherlands because
Bangladesh has less economic support.
C. The Netherlands has a greater environmental risk than Bangladesh because the
coast of the Netherlands is closer to melting Arctic ice sheets.
D. The Netherlands has a greater environmental risk than Bangladesh because a larger
portion of its population resides near the coast. - Answers -B. Bangladesh has a greater
environmental risk than the Netherlands because Bangladesh has less economic
support.

Which type of migration was the trafficking of slaves from Africa?

A. Voluntary
B. Involuntary
C. Intraregional
D. Interregional - Answers -B. Involuntary

Which group of migrants have been affected by the war in Syria?

A. Palestinian migrants
B. Lebanese migrants
C. Turkish migrants
D. Iraqi migrants - Answers -A. Palestinian migrants
